Staying Strong: Building Resilience and Overcoming Obstacles
Building resilience isn't about being invincible; it's about bouncing back from adversity. It's about learning to adapt, to adjust, and to find strength in the face of challenges. Think of it like this: your mental health is like a muscle. The more you work it, the stronger it becomes. How do you build that mental muscle? By practicing healthy habits and coping mechanisms. One of the biggest things here is taking care of yourself. This is so important. Eat well, exercise regularly, and get enough sleep. These simple things can make a huge difference in your mental health and well-being. When you're physically healthy, you're better equipped to handle stress and overcome obstacles.
Find healthy ways to cope with stress. This could be anything from meditation and deep breathing exercises to spending time in nature or pursuing hobbies you enjoy. It’s important to give yourself the proper time to reset. Connect with people who support you. Build a strong support network of friends, family, or mentors. Having people you can rely on during tough times can make all the difference. Sharing your feelings, seeking advice, and knowing that you're not alone can provide immense comfort and strength. Look for the silver linings. Even in the darkest of times, there's always something to be grateful for. Focusing on the positive aspects of your life can help you maintain a sense of hope and optimism. Remember that this is a journey. There will be ups and downs, victories and setbacks. Overcoming obstacles is a process, not a destination. Be patient with yourself, celebrate your progress, and keep moving forward. With each challenge you overcome, you become stronger, wiser, and more resilient. The ability to endure is a testament to the perseverance of the human spirit.
The Power of Perspective: Finding Silver Linings and Maintaining Hope
One of the most powerful tools we have for navigating life's challenges is perspective. How we view a situation can have a profound impact on how we feel and how we respond. When you're going through a tough time, it's easy to get tunnel vision and focus only on the negative. But by shifting your perspective, you can often find silver linings and maintain hope. Here are a few ways to do that. Try to zoom out, take a step back and look at the bigger picture. Ask yourself: Will this matter in a week? A month? A year? Often, when you gain distance, things seem less daunting. A little time can put things in perspective. Another method is to look for the lessons learned. Every challenge offers an opportunity for growth and learning. What can you take away from this experience? What have you learned about yourself? How can you use this knowledge to become stronger and more resilient? Focusing on the positive, and practicing gratitude. Even in difficult times, there are usually things to be thankful for. Focusing on the good things in your life can help you maintain a sense of hope and optimism. When faced with obstacles, remember that you are not alone. Many people have faced similar challenges and have come out on the other side. Share your experiences with others and listen to their stories. Seek professional support. If you are struggling to cope with a difficult situation, consider seeking help from a therapist or counselor. They can provide guidance and support, and help you develop healthy coping mechanisms. This can play a big role in your mental health journey. The ability to maintain hope is a powerful force. It can help you get through tough times and create a better future. The practice of maintaining perspective, finding silver linings, and focusing on the positive aspects of your life can have a dramatic impact. By viewing life’s challenges with an open mind, you’re on the right path.
